WebThey almost always collect these pieces out of order. Each scene is planned before shooting, down to the camera angles required to construct it. Those individual shots come together to form a scene, scenes stitch together to make a sequence, and individual sequences create the entire narrative. ... The fourth element of filmmaking is editing ... WebThe next step for an editor is typically working alone on the first pass of the film, called a rough cut. This part of the process is known as the assembly, where the editor roughly assembles all of the raw footage. At this point, the film runs too long, the shots are not precise, and the pacing is loose — but everything is in the correct order. WebApr 11, 2024 · PLAN C is a true ensemble documentary, with many people and places. Stitching it together from 300 hours of footage in a digestible and entertaining way was a real challenge. To manage, we cut the film into what we called “pods”. A pod consisted of a stand-alone character and/or concept that had a beginning, middle, and end (or “button”). 原宿 グミ売ってる場所

WebNov 25, 2024 · Stage 4: Post-Production Stage. Once the production stage of the filmmaking process is complete and the necessary footages are ‘ in the can’ and ready … Web5. Cut on Motion. Motion distracts the eye from noticing editing cuts. So, when cutting from one image to another, always try to do it when the subject is in motion. For example, …

WebNov 25, 2024 · Stage 4: Post-Production Stage. Once the production stage of the filmmaking process is complete and the necessary footages are ‘ in the can’ and ready to be assembled, then, it is time for post-production. The post-production activities include editing, sound mixing, music and, if necessary, computer-generated imagery. WebOct 3, 2024 · Stage 1: Logging. The first thing you’re going to do is log your footage. This is where you sort through all of your source video material, cut out all the usable clips, group them into bins, then label those bins accordingly. That way when you’re searching for a …

Instead of using ellipsis for the sake of economy, this approach uses it to construct an idea and a very ... bepop ドライバーWebApr 6, 2024 · 2. Cutting on Action for Transitions. Image by Veles Studio. Cutting on action is one of the core fundamentals of film editing to create a sense of fluid and continuous movement.
